Industrial plumbing repair services involve diagnosing and fixing complex plumbing issues that can disrupt the operation of commercial and industrial facilities. These services typically address problems such as leaking pipes, clogged drains, broken fixtures, and malfunctioning water systems.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to ensure that the plumbing systems are restored to proper working order, minimizing downtime and preventing further damage. Whether it’s a small leak or a major pipe failure, professional repair services help maintain the safety and efficiency of industrial environments.

These services are essential for resolving a variety of plumbing problems that can occur in large-scale properties. Common issues include pipe corrosion, pressure problems, water line breaks, and sewer line blockages. Industrial plumbing repair also covers repairs to specialized systems like sprinkler lines, cooling water systems, and process piping.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ent costly water damage, reduce operational disruptions, and extend the lifespan of plumbing infrastructure. The overview below groups typical Industrial Plumbing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for routine plumbing fixes like leaking faucets or minor pipe repairs usually range from $150 to $600. Most projects fall within this middle range, depending on the specific issue and accessibility.

Pipe Replacement - replacing sections of damaged or corroded pipes can cost between $1,000 and $3,500 for many residential projects. Larger or more complex replacements may push costs higher, but most jobs stay within this range.

Full System Replacement - complete overhauls of industrial plumbing systems often range from $5,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the system. These projects are less common and typically involve extensive work.

Emergency Repairs - urgent plumbing services, such as major leaks or burst pipes, generally cost between $300 and $1,500 for many local contractors. The final price can vary based on the severity and timing of the repair.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
